Pike seeking CDBG money for four projects

Milford- Pike County will receive $270,126 in Community Development Block Grant funding, for four projects. This year’s funding is down from the over $300,000 received for the last grant period.

A second hearing on the application was held during Wednesday’s county commissioner meeting. 

The projects are:

  • Matamoras $57,000 to pave a parking lot at Airport Park,  
  • Shohola $83,500 to complete Rohman Park,
  • Milford $77,045 for a borough parking lot,
  • Greene Township $7,395 for its fire communications tower

$30,186 will be for program administration.
